Prayagraj, Jan 23 (NationPress) Jagadguru Rambhadracharya has highlighted the profound significance of Mahakumbh in a special interview with IANS conducted here on Thursday.

Rambhadracharya responded to numerous questions and shared his perspectives on a variety of topics. He remarked that the Mahakumbh bears great importance and that participating in the dip during this event provides numerous advantages.

"This is a pivotal day for Sanatan culture. The entire globe is discussing the Mahakumbh," he stated.

When discussing the trend of creating Instagram reels during the event, Rambhadracharya expressed that such occurrences should not take place at the Mahakumbh. He feels that the current situation in this regard is inappropriate.

In response to a question about notable political figures attending the event, including Defence Minister Rajnath Singh and other dignitaries, he commented: "It is commendable that esteemed leaders from the nation are here to take a dip."

When asked about the absence of Congress MP Rahul Gandhi, Rambhadracharya expressed, "It is regrettable that the opposition leader has not yet participated."

Regarding Akhilesh Yadav's absence from Prayagraj, Rambhadracharya inquired, "What is his opposition to the Ganga? Why is he hesitant to visit the Ganga?"

On the topic of Donald Trump becoming the President of the United States, he commented: "It is positive that he assumed the presidency of America."

As of Thursday morning, reports indicated that at least 700,000 individuals had already taken a dip.

On Wednesday alone, over 4.87 million people performed the sacred dip, showcasing the profound faith and devotion of the attendees.

In addition, the ongoing Mahakumbh has surpassed the 10-crore mark for participants bathing at the Triveni Sangam, the confluence of the Ganga, Yamuna, and the mythical Saraswati rivers, as reported by the Uttar Pradesh government on Thursday.

The state government reported that this milestone was reached on Thursday at 12 p.m.

The Uttar Pradesh government is hosting the world’s largest religious gathering, which commenced on January 13 and will continue until February 26.
